Ruminate magazine is seeking submissions of fiction, prose, poetry, and images.
 
Founded in 2006, RUMINATE is a reputable national publication with contributors such as Tyrus Clutter, Frederick Buechner, Luci Shaw, and Scott Kolbo. 

Only submissions that are previously unpublished are accepted. Contributors are paid with either a one-year subscription or contributor single copies. If you agree to allow RUMINATE to publish your work, they will receive first serial rights. Before submitting, they strongly recommend ordering a copy of the magazine in order to better understand the type of work they publish and to tailor your submission accordingly. All artists and writers previously published in RUMINATE to wait two reading periods before submitting again. RUMINATE ONLY accepts online submissions, as our readers are spread out across the country. Any submissions made by postal mail or email will not be considered.

Themes/Deadlines
Winter Issue #18, Sounds and Silence: Deadline August 15th, 2010
Spring Issue #19, Sustaining: Dealine November 15th, 2010
